9 Installation Considerations for Installing an Energy Storage System

 
When you purchase an energy storage system, few suppliers will tell you what to pay attention to during installation and use, especially when installing lithium battery clusters. Currently, the voltage of industrial and commercial energy storage battery clusters is typically above 500V. Improper installation and use can lead to serious consequences, such as short circuits, fires, electric shocks, and other hazards. We have also summarized the following key points to consider when installing lithium batteries.
 
1. Select the Appropriate Battery Specifications
Choose a lithium battery pack with suitable capacity, voltage, and power according to actual needs, ensuring compatibility with other equipment. Because LiFePO4 is more stable and safer, energy storage batteries now choose LiFePO4.
 
2. Ensure Proper Heat Dissipation
Lithium batteries generate heat during charging and discharging. Ensure adequate ventilation and heat dissipation during installation to prevent the batteries from overheating.
 
3. Avoid Short Circuits and Incorrect Wiring
During installation, strictly follow the correct connection sequence of the battery’s positive and negative terminals to avoid short circuits and incorrect wiring, which could lead to battery damage or fire.
 
4. Keep the Environment Dry
Lithium batteries should be installed in a dry, moisture-free environment to prevent the batteries from becoming damp, reducing the risk of electrolyte leakage or short circuits.
 
5. Fire Safety Measures
In extreme conditions, lithium batteries may experience thermal runaway or even catch fire. Install necessary fire safety equipment, such as dry powder or CO2 extinguishers.
 
6. Avoid Mechanical Damage
During installation, avoid subjecting the batteries to impacts or punctures, as this could lead to internal short circuits or leaks, increasing the safety risk.
 
7. Regular Maintenance and Inspection
Regularly check the battery’s condition, including appearance, wiring, and voltage, ensuring it operates within normal parameters, and promptly address any abnormalities.
 
8. Compliant Installation and Operation
Strictly follow the manufacturer’s installation guidelines and operation manual to ensure the system complies with local electrical safety standards.
 
9. Storage and Transportation Precautions
When storing lithium batteries, avoid exposing them to high temperatures, direct sunlight, or flammable materials. During transportation, handle the batteries carefully to prevent damage to the casing.

PV Cables: The Backbone of Solar Installations

PV cables play a vital role in connecting solar panels, inverters, and batteries, forming the backbone of a solar energy system. Among the various types available, the DC cable is the primary conductor responsible for carrying the direct current generated by solar panels. These cables are insulated and designed to handle high currents while minimizing power loss over long distances.

Solar Cables: Protecting Power Generation

Solar cables, specifically engineered for solar installations, are designed to endure weather conditions such as extreme temperatures, UV radiation, and moisture exposure. Their robust insulation protects against wear and tear, ensuring long-lasting and efficient power generation. For smaller systems or low-power applications, 4mm2 solar cables provide a cost-effective yet reliable solution for interconnecting solar modules.

Enhanced Performance with 6mm Single Core Solar Cables

For larger solar arrays and higher power requirements, 6mm Single Core Solar Cables come into play. These cables offer increased current-carrying capacity and reduced voltage drop, resulting in enhanced overall system efficiency. By minimizing energy losses along the cable length, these cables ensure maximum power output from your solar panels to the inverter, maximizing the return on your investment.

Single Core PV Cables: Versatility and Adaptability

Single Core PV Cables are widely used in solar installations due to their versatile nature and adaptability to different system designs. They are available in various sizes, ranging from 4 to 16 mm², allowing customization based on specific power requirements. Their high-quality insulation ensures efficient power transmission and protection against environmental factors, making them a reliable choice for any solar project.

The Growing Demand for Solar Lights in Urban Areas

With the increasing global focus on green energy and sustainable development, solar powered lights, as a key application of new energy technology, are rapidly becoming a popular choice in urban lighting. Entering 2024, the market potential, technological advancements, and policy support surrounding solar lights all point to their strong future growth. Solar lights are now seen as an integral solution for cities seeking to balance energy efficiency with environmental sustainability.

 

The market for solar powered street lights has been steadily expanding in recent years, with this growth expected to accelerate in the coming years. Globally, there is an increasing demand for green, environmentally-friendly, and energy-efficient products, driving the expansion of the solar lighting market. In regions experiencing rapid urbanization and infrastructure development, solar LED lighting offers a cost-effective and eco-friendly solution. This makes them particularly attractive in cities where energy consumption is high, and the push for sustainability is becoming more urgent.

 

Technological advancements have played a crucial role in increasing the adoption of solar street lights. Improvements in photovoltaic technology have significantly boosted the efficiency of solar panels, enabling them to generate more electricity under the same sunlight conditions. This development has extended the operating time of LED solar lights. Additionally, advancements in LED lighting technology have improved the brightness and energy efficiency of SLD solar lights, making them more reliable and effective in urban lighting projects.

 

SLD solar lights 

Government policies and incentives are another key factor in the growing demand for solar lights. Many governments have introduced financial incentives such as subsidies, tax breaks, and reduced installation costs to encourage the adoption of renewable energy technologies. These policies make it easier for cities to invest in solar street lights, accelerating their deployment. By promoting green energy solutions, these policies also help governments meet their environmental targets and drive innovation in the renewable energy sector.

 

Beyond their economic and practical benefits, solar street lights also contribute to environmental protection by reducing fossil fuel consumption and cutting down on greenhouse gas emissions. As cities strive to become greener and more sustainable, solar lighting helps reduce the urban carbon footprint. Furthermore, modern solar street lights come in various designs that can enhance urban aesthetics, blending functionality with visual appeal in parks, public spaces, and along roadways. The Significance of Foundation Solar Mounting

A solid foundation is the backbone of any structure, and the same concept applies to solar panel installations. Foundation solar mounting provides the necessary stability and support for solar panels, maximizing their energy-capturing potential. By securely anchoring the panels to the ground, foundation solar mounting ensures that they can withstand various weather conditions, including high winds and heavy snow loads.

Ground Rack System: A Smart Choice

Among the different types of solar mounting systems, ground rack systems have gained immense popularity due to their versatility and cost-effectiveness. Unlike roof-mounted systems, ground rack systems are installed directly on the ground, using a simple yet sturdy metal framework. This design allows for easy adjustment and optimization of the panels’ tilt and orientation, maximizing solar exposure throughout the day.

Benefits of a Ground Solar Mounting System

  1. Optimal Efficiency: With a ground rack system, you have the flexibility to position your solar panels at the ideal angle and direction for maximum sunlight absorption. This helps to maximize the system’s energy output, leading to higher returns on your solar investment.

  2. Easy Maintenance: Ground rack systems make it easier to access and maintain solar panels. Cleaning and upkeep become hassle-free tasks, ensuring that your solar system operates at peak efficiency for years to come.

  3. Scalability: Ground rack systems allow for easier expansion of your solar energy project compared to roof-mounted systems. As energy needs grow, you can easily add more panels to your ground rack system without the limitations often associated with roof spaces.

  4. Cost-Effective: Ground rack systems typically have lower installation costs compared to roof-mounted systems, as they require less structural modifications. Additionally, since there is no need to penetrate the roof, there is minimal risk of leaks or damage.

  5. Ideal for Various Locations: Ground rack systems are suitable for various terrains, including uneven or sloping landscapes. This makes them a viable option for both residential and commercial projects regardless of the location and topography.
